A second-half double by substitute John Baird helped Montrose seal a deserved victory at Cliftonhill.
Montrose took the lead after 33 minutes when Keith Gibson headed a Gary Wood cross into the top corner.
Albion defender Alan Reid was given a straight red card on 72 minutes for a professional foul on Baird.
Alan Benton then fouled Baird inside the box and the striker scored past David Scott. Baird then grabbed his second on 83 minutes.
